Most of us have seen the excitement involved with playing a digital game. A vast majority of people play games as a pastime now. If educators could harness the excitement and engagement of playing digital games in the classrooms, then students would truly experience hands-on, brains-on learning using the digital media that is an everyday part of their lives outside of schools. This interactive presentation is based on the book "Game On: Using Digital Games to Transform Teaching, Learning, and Assessment" and designed for PK-12 teachers and curriculum specialists to find, critique, and evaluate potential digital games for instruction, explore potential instructional strategies to use during digital game-based learning experiences, and determine meaningful assessment practices.
